state

[1/1]

  1. ReactのsetStateが状態を更新しない問題についての日本語解説
    ReactのsetStateメソッドを使って状態を更新しようとしても、実際の状態が更新されないことがあります。これは、Reactの内部的な最適化や非同期処理の影響で発生することが多いです。原因と解決方法:非同期処理:setStateの呼び出しが非同期処理内にある場合、状態の更新が遅延されることがあります。解決方法: setStateのコールバック関数を利用して、状態の更新が完了した後に処理を実行します。this
  2. JavaScript, React.js, Stateの更新: state.item[1]の変更
    問題: React. jsのstateオブジェクト内の配列itemの2番目の要素(state. item[1])を更新したい。解決方法:setStateメソッドを使用します。setStateは、新しいstateオブジェクトをReactに渡すことで、コンポーネントのレンダリングをトリガーします。
  3. ReactでsetStateを使ってオブジェクト状態を更新するコード例の詳細解説
    ReactにおけるsetStateメソッドは、コンポーネントの状態を更新する際に使用されます。オブジェクトの状態を更新する場合、従来のJavaScriptの割り当て方法とは異なり、setStateのコールバック関数内で変更を行います。this
  4. パフォーマンスと使いやすさのバランス:Reactにおけるステート更新のベストプラクティス
    Reactは、ステート更新の順序を保証しません。ステート更新関数が複数回呼び出されても、必ずしもその呼び出し順序通りに更新が反映されるとは限りません。詳細Reactでは、ステート更新は非同期的に処理されます。これは、パフォーマンスを向上させ、バッチ処理による効率化を可能にするためです。しかし、非同期処理であるため、ステート更新の順序が保証されないという問題が生じます。
  5. React.ComponentとReact.PureComponentの違い
    主な違いは、shouldComponentUpdateの実装にあります。React. Componentは、shouldComponentUpdateを実装していないため、デフォルトでは常に再レンダリングされます。React. PureComponentは、shouldComponentUpdateを浅い比較で実装しています。つまり、propsとstateが前回と異なっていなければ再レンダリングされません。
  6. 【React Hooks】useEffectとuseReducerでsetStateの更新を自在に操る
    この挙動は意図的なものですが、場合によっては問題になることがあります。例えば、入力フォームでユーザーが入力した値をリアルタイムに反映したい場合などです。本記事では、React setState not Updating Immediately 問題について、その原因と解決策を詳しく解説します。
  7. Reactで`setState`の完了を待ってから関数をトリガーする方法【完全ガイド】
    そこで、setState の完了を待ってから関数をトリガーするには、主に以下の2つの方法があります。コールバック関数を使用するsetState の第二引数にコールバック関数を渡すことで、setState の完了後に実行される処理を定義することができます。